Vitamin B12 absorption begins in the mouth but mainly occurs in the stomach and small intestine with the help of intrinsic factor, a protein that helps your body absorb B12. Weight loss surgery results in anatomical changes, such as a smaller stomach, reduced stomach acidity, and changes to the small intestine, that can lead to vitamin B12 malabsorption and decreased intrinsic factor secretion
